Andre Dogan is the Technology Partnerships Director at Make, formerly known as Integromat.2 He is responsible for managing technology partnerships and business development for the company. Make is a no-code automation platform that allows users to connect various apps and automate workflows.2

In his role, Andre Dogan works on expanding Make's ecosystem of technology partners and integrations. For example, he recently commented on a partnership between Make and Klippa, an Intelligent Document Processing (IDP) vendor. Dogan stated, "We're excited for Klippa as a new Make application and technology partner, together empowering businesses with the tools they need to automate and optimize their operations."2

Make, previously Integromat, is a company founded in 2012 that specializes in IT services, software development, and automation solutions. As of 2024, the company had an annual revenue of $6 million and employed 23 people.1
